Reviewed by Tony Cummings

The book's subhead is Favourite Hymns And Their Stories. Peter Harvey, aided by a survey identifying the 20 most popular hymns in Britain, sets out to tell the stories of around 50 or so hymns. "Stories" probably isn't always the right word for though there are some riveting tales here there are other instances when we are offered mere biographic notes on the writers. But there's still much useful research here.
